The company’s sales and EPS miss in fourth-quarter fiscal 2025. Weak storm-related demand, sluggish big-ticket spending, and margin pressure hurt results. Muted comps and operating deleverage are weighing on profitability, while a cautious outlook reflects persistent housing weakness and limited demand recovery.Nevertheless, Home Depot’s growth strategy is well-supported by its integrated retail model, digital investments, and Pro-focused initiatives. Seamless connectivity across stores, online platforms, and supply chain is enhancing customer experience and driving higher engagement. The Pro segment continues to outperform, supported by targeted investments and expanding ecosystem capabilities. The company continues to benefit from its resilient off-price model, strong value proposition and steady demand across apparel and home categories. Comparable sales growth across divisions reflects the effectiveness of its merchandising strategy and ability to drive consistent customer traffic. TJX also sees long-term growth opportunities through global store expansion and disciplined execution across its retail banners. Strong cash and a healthy balance sheet provide financial flexibility to support investments, expansion and continued shareholder returns through dividends and share repurchases. However, the company faces headwinds from high store wages and payroll costs. The company is benefiting from the strong demand environment across the data center end market. Its data center end market is gaining from AI-driven demand for custom XPU silicon. The Zacks analyst model estimates suggest that the data center end market’s revenues will witness a CAGR of 31.1% through fiscal 2027-2029. The recently expanded partnership with NVIDIA significantly strengthens Marvell’s long-term growth outlook by embedding it deeper into the fast-growing AI infrastructure ecosystem. Its strong cash flow generation capability and aggressive shareholder return policy are praiseworthy. Nonetheless, its near-term prospects might be hurt by a weakening global economy amid ongoing macroeconomic and geopolitical issues. This microcap company with a market capitalization of $243.23 million has diversified its business model across community banking, mortgage banking, and consumer finance provides stability and resilience through market fluctuations. C&F Financial’s balance sheet expansion supports consistent net interest income, with growth in loans and deposits enhancing its financial health. The mortgage banking segment has experienced significant growth in loan originations, contributing positively to profitability.
